logo

Output 3fb566f179cc5bcaa49865847da9e1efa18c41cbfc886d57bd5b3cf924f9bf7a:0

value
305185937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af6167d505c10f20c4ca9995d8fb93bf5672a6c3 OP_EQUAL
address
3HgLryQozQukVLkYZgcDY1xJTFd9DMD3AB
transaction
3fb566f179cc5bcaa49865847da9e1efa18c41cbfc886d57bd5b3cf924f9bf7a